Two Duncan dentists are offering what could be a life-saving service.

Dr. Jolene Benham and Dr. Dale Benham of Alderlea Dental Health on Festubert Street are marking Oral Health Month with their own campaign to battle oral cancer.

Using Velscope, an oral cancer examination tool developed in Canada, Alderlea Dental Health will be holding an Oral Cancer Screening Day in Duncan on April 13.

“Oral cancer is a preventable and screenable cancer, yet continues to be diagnosed in later stages with very high mortality rates,” says Jolene.

The dental team will complete free oral cancer screenings for any area resident at the 11-301 Festubert St. location. The procedure takes only 20 minutes.

“Many have been touched by cancer in one form or another, and this has strengthened our resolve to host this event,” Jolene explains.

Approximately 25 per cent of the diagnoses are now in patients who do not smoke tobacco. A full 37 per cent of those diagnosed die within five years. However, when detected early, survival rates exceed 90 per cent over five years.

The Velscope, used in combination with the traditional head, neck, and oral tissue exam can lead to early detection. The federal government recommends annual oral cancer screening for all adults 25 years of age and older, regardless of tobacco usage.

“For this reason, Alderlea Dental Health is making this investment in time and technology to benefit our patients’ overall health,” Jolene says.
